I can't configure USB 3G Modem (Prolink PHS300)

Asked by Mijanur Rahman

I have a PROLINK HSUPA PHS300 USB 3G modem. I can use it in windows XP/7/Vista/8. But recently about one year ago I upgrade my windows into Ubuntu. Now I am using Ubuntu 12.04 LTS 32-bit operating system. I have configured many USB Modem but I can't still configure it. When I put the modem into the slot and wait 20 secound after that the modems red light turn into green and after sometime the system shows "you are registerd to home network" and at the corner in Network Manager Applet it shows "New mobile broadband (GSM)" and I correctly setup step by step. But then I can't connect it to internet. I have configure wvdial but when I dial it shows "modem not responding"
